About Master of Professional Engineering, Master Degree - at University of Newcastle, Australia

The University of Newcastle's Master of Professional Engineering (MPE) is a highly flexible, advanced engineering degree. Students have the opportunity to complete a 3-year degree or an accelerated program, depending on their career goals and background.

Make a Career Change to Engineering: 3-year MPE

Are you seeking to make a career change into engineering? If you have a background in a related area, such as science or mathematics, the 3-year MPE provides an opportunity for you to gain a professionally recognised qualification in engineering.

You will build on your fundamental knowledge through foundational engineering courses, gain expert technical knowledge in your area of specialisation, and develop professional practice skills in project management and complex problem solving.

NOTE: The 3-year program is only available in the disciplines of Civil, Electrical and Electronic and Mechanical engineering.

Get Professional Recognition in Australia: 2-year Accelerated MPE

If you already have an engineering degree from an overseas university but are seeking professional recognition, this 2-year accelerated MPE will give you an advanced, accredited qualification, preparing you for practice in Australia and around the world.

You will deepen your technical knowledge in your area of specialisation, learn about engineering practice in the Australian context and develop professional skills in project management and complex problem solving.

Advance Your Engineering Career: 1-year Accelerated MPE

If you are already a professionally recognised engineer, the 1-year accelerated MPE will allow you to gain a highly relevant postgraduate qualification to help advance your career.

As well as deepening your technical knowledge with advanced courses in your area of specialisation, you will also diversify your skills in an area outside of engineering, such as business, management, entrepreneurship and innovation, health and safety or disaster risk reduction.

Entry requirements

3-year program - A STEM based Bachelor degree, other than engineering, with at least 20 units (UON equivalent) of mathematics covering algebra and linear calculus.

2-year program - A named Engineering degree in an aligned discipline area to applicant’s preferred MPE. The degree must be equivalent to the Sydney Accord standards.

1-year program - A University of Newcastle Engineering degree, or equivalent, in the same discipline area.

English language requirements: Overall IELTS 6.5 with no band score less than 6, or successful completion of a diploma or above that was wholly conducted and assessed in English of two or more years of study within the last five years, or equivalent.
